shopee-openapi-v2
Version:
shopee open api sdk
42 lines • 2.7 kB
JavaScript
;
/*
* @Author: Monve
* @Date: 2022-06-07 19:49:42
* @LastEditors: Monve
* @LastEditTime: 2022-07-22 18:54:40
* @FilePath: /shopee-openapi-v2/src/product.ts
*/
Object.defineProperty(exports, "__esModule", { value: true });
exports.ProductApi = void 0;
const tslib_1 = require("tslib");
const request_1 = require("./utils/request");
class ProductApi {
}
tslib_1.__decorate([
(0, request_1.Get)({ url: '/api/v2/product/get_item_base_info' }),
tslib_1.__metadata("design:type", Function)
], ProductApi.prototype, "getItemBaseInfo", void 0);
tslib_1.__decorate([
(0, request_1.Get)({ url: '/api/v2/product/get_item_extra_info' }),
tslib_1.__metadata("design:type", Function)
], ProductApi.prototype, "getItemExtraInfo", void 0);
tslib_1.__decorate([
(0, request_1.Get)({
url: '/api/v2/product/get_item_list',
paramsSerializer: (params) => {
return Object.keys(params).map((key) => {
if (key === 'item_status') {
return params[key].split(',').map((statu) => `item_status=${statu}`).join('&');
}
return `${key}=${params[key]}`;
}).join('&');
}
}),
tslib_1.__metadata("design:type", Function)
], ProductApi.prototype, "getItemList", void 0);
tslib_1.__decorate([
(0, request_1.Get)({ url: '/api/v2/product/get_model_list' }),
tslib_1.__metadata("design:type", Function)
], ProductApi.prototype, "getModelList", void 0);
exports.ProductApi = ProductApi;
//# sourceMappingURL=data:application/json;base64,eyJ2ZXJzaW9uIjozLCJmaWxlIjoicHJvZHVjdC5qcyIsInNvdXJjZVJvb3QiOiIiLCJzb3VyY2VzIjpbIi4uL3NyYy9wcm9kdWN0LnRzIl0sIm5hbWVzIjpbXSwibWFwcGluZ3MiOiI7QUFBQTs7Ozs7O0dBTUc7Ozs7QUFFSCw2Q0FBb0Q7QUFHcEQsTUFBYSxVQUFVO0NBMFB0QjtBQXZQQztJQURDLElBQUEsYUFBRyxFQUFDLEVBQUUsR0FBRyxFQUFFLG9DQUFvQyxFQUFFLENBQUM7O21EQXdJbEQ7QUFHRDtJQURDLElBQUEsYUFBRyxFQUFDLEVBQUUsR0FBRyxFQUFFLHFDQUFxQyxFQUFFLENBQUM7O29EQWdCbkQ7QUFhRDtJQVhDLElBQUEsYUFBRyxFQUFDO1FBQ0gsR0FBRyxFQUFFLCtCQUErQjtRQUNwQyxnQkFBZ0IsRUFBRSxDQUFDLE1BQU0sRUFBRSxFQUFFO1lBQzNCLE9BQU8sTUFBTSxDQUFDLElBQUksQ0FBQyxNQUFNLENBQUMsQ0FBQyxHQUFHLENBQUMsQ0FBQyxHQUFHLEVBQUUsRUFBRTtnQkFDckMsSUFBSSxHQUFHLEtBQUssYUFBYSxFQUFFO29CQUN6QixPQUFRLE1BQU0sQ0FBQyxHQUFHLENBQVksQ0FBQyxLQUFLLENBQUMsR0FBRyxDQUFDLENBQUMsR0FBRyxDQUFDLENBQUMsS0FBSyxFQUFFLEVBQUUsQ0FBQyxlQUFlLEtBQUssRUFBRSxDQUFDLENBQUMsSUFBSSxDQUFDLEdBQUcsQ0FBQyxDQUFBO2lCQUMzRjtnQkFDRCxPQUFPLEdBQUcsR0FBRyxJQUFJLE1BQU0sQ0FBQyxHQUFHLENBQUMsRUFBRSxDQUFBO1lBQ2hDLENBQUMsQ0FBQyxDQUFDLElBQUksQ0FBQyxHQUFHLENBQUMsQ0FBQTtRQUNkLENBQUM7S0FDRixDQUFDOzsrQ0FvQkQ7QUFHRDtJQURDLElBQUEsYUFBRyxFQUFDLEVBQUUsR0FBRyxFQUFFLGdDQUFnQyxFQUFFLENBQUM7O2dEQTBEOUM7QUF4UEgsZ0NBMFBDIn0=